Question Need Intake Recommendations

I'm looking for something that will work with this. I like DK's breather bolt solution, but not super crazy about the look of the 587. I've tried a couple different covers, but nothing is really striking me.

I like the tapered shape of the Ness Big Sucker, but don't want to lose the DK breather bolts. I also don't want to put anything more restrictive on either. Any suggestions in the $200 range that will bolt up to this?

Hey man!

The Forcewinder elbow bolts directly up to the throttle body support bracket with the Outlaw Breather bolts. Here's a few pics-







I have also seen some adapter plates on ebay that you can put between the SE Heavy Breather and the support bracket that effectively convert the SE HB to the standard bolt pattern.

I just looked and did not see any of these on ebay right now...I may be missing them, or maybe none are up for sale right now.
